Hot on the heels of the Fifth Round results, I bring you the fixtures for the last 16 of the Fantasy Football Scout Cup III, sponsored by Paddy Power. With just eight match-ups to look at this time, it’s clear to see that the competition is reaching it’s conclusion. So without further ado, here are the all important fixtures…

  1. Back to Back Ballacks Vs. gooner dave
  2. DRP Vs. Animons
  3. Manif Vs. tippman
  4. Roger Vs. DaFoe22
  5. Ann_der_roo Vs. User
  6. sandgrounder Vs. Anorak
  7. BigRig Vs. Dksbananas
  8. DollyDaisy Vs. RJBroughton

The first fixture sees 3,297th in the world gooner dave taking on Back to Back Ballacks, who sits 85,623rd. Plenty of differentials in this one, with just six identical players. Despite the gulf in overall rank, it’s actually Back to Back Ballacks who has the greater squad value, so this tie is very difficult to call. Tevez could be the difference.

Next up, we have a closely-matched tie, as DRP (sitting on 665 points) takes on Animons (on 664 points). That point lead effectively gives DRP a half-point advantage going into the game, provided he doesn’t make another transfer.

Then we see tournament-outsider Manif, who is the lowest ranked manager left in the competition (despite moving up over 400k places since before round one), taking on tippman, who of course beat Mark in the very first round.

Last week’s top-scorer Roger (1,851st overall), has been drawn against DaFoe22 (6,028th overall). Once again the lower-ranked contender has the, albeit slight, team value advantage. An unusual tactic from Roger, sees him looking for the clean sheets that cost. With Petr Cech setting you back £6.7m, Ashley Cole £8.3m, Nemanja Vidic £7.4m and Leighton Baines£7.0m (with Seamus Coleman there to double up on Everton defenders), good defensive returns could be enough to see Roger through to the quarter-finals.

Round three top-scorer, and highest ranked manager in the competition, Ann_der_roo (44th in the world) takes on 13,266th in the world, User.

Spurs-fan Anorak will have his loyalties tested when he takes on sandgrounder, as Rafael Van der Vaart looks to be a key differential for the latter. On the flip-side, Liverpool-fan sandgrounder will have his loyalties tested when he takes on Anorak, as Paul Konchesky looks to be a key differential for the latter.

The penultimate tie of the round pits BigRig against Dksbananas. Both will be looking to show their bouncebackability and end the week with not only a quarter-final place, but also a green arrow.

Last, but by no means least, is DollyDaisy‘s game against RJBroughton. Both men sit locked together on 667 points, but it’s DollyDaisy’s superior midfield of Cesc Fabregas, Tim Cahill, Rafael Van der Vaart, Mikel Arteta and Matthew Etherington, to RJBroughton’s midfield of Clint Dempsey, Luis Nani, Gareth Bale, Mikel Arteta and Karl Henry, that will be the key difference for me.

So that’s that, all fixtures will be played out over Gameweek 13, and I’ll bring you the results early next week, before the live quarter-final draw on next podcast. As always, the top-scorer for the round will earn a free £25 bet courtesy of Paddy Power.

    Those Opta Stats ready and rocking for the masses.

    Aston Villa v Manchester United
    •Villa have won none of the last 14 Premier League games against Manchester United at Villa Park, but have drawn the last two.
    •69% of the goals Villa have scored have been netted in the first half, the highest proportion in the top division.
    •The Red Devils have lost only one of their last 42 Premier League matches in the midlands since 1998: 0-1 at Wolves in January 2004.

    Manchester City v Birmingham City
    •Emmanuel Adebayor has scored four goals in four Premier League appearances against Birmingham.
    •Carlos Tevez has scored three goals in four Premier League games against Birmingham.
    •Alex McLeish's team have kept just one clean sheet in their last 15 Premier League away games and they have conceded more than one goal in 12 of those matches.

    Newcastle United v Fulham

    •Fulham have not won any of their last 24 Premier League away matches.
    •Fulham have kept a clean sheet on their last three trips to the North East in the Premier League.
    •Newcastle have picked up 27 yellow cards, more than any other side in the top division.
    •62% of the goals Fulham have conceded have come in the first half, the highest proportion in the top flight.

    Stoke City v Liverpool
    •Stoke have only kept one clean sheet in their last 13 Premier League matches.
    •Tony Pulis' side haven't won back to back Premier League home games since August 2009.
    •85% of the goals Stoke have scored have come in the second half, the highest proportion in the top flight.

    Tottenham Hotspur v Blackburn Rovers
    •Roman Pavlyuchenko has scored three goals in his two Premier League matches against Blackburn.
    •Spurs have gone four games without a win in the Premier League, their longest run since January 2009.
    •Harry Redknapp's team have failed to keep a clean sheet in their last 11 Premier League matches.
    •Rafael van der Vaart has scored in all six of his appearances at White Hart Lane in all competitions

    West Ham United vs Blackpool
    •The Hammers have won only one of their last seven Premier League matches at Upton Park.
    •Ian Holloway's side have allowed their opponents 81 shots on target against them, more than any other team.
    •West Ham have the joint-worst home record in the Premier League this term, with five points and a goal difference of -4, just ahead of Blackpool with five points and a goal difference of -1.

    Wigan Athletic v West Bromwich Albion
    •Four of the five league meetings between these two sides in Wigan have ended 1-0.
    •West Brom have only won one of their last 22 Premier League away games.
    •Wigan have only won one of their last eight Premier League matches at the DW Stadium.
    •The Latics have only kept one clean sheet in their last nine Premier League home matches.

    Wolverhampton Wanderers v Bolton Wanderers
    •Bolton have found the net in seven of their last eight games at Molineux in all competitions
    •Both of Johan Elmander's away goals for Bolton in the league last season came in the Midlands: one at Wolves and one at Aston Villa, though the Trotters lost both games.
    •Bolton are the first team ever to draw four consecutive matches by a 1-1 scoreline away from home.
    •Four of Bolton's goals have been netted by substitutes, a joint-league high along with Chelsea.
    •Bolton have drawn seven matches so far, a joint-league high along with Sunderland and Fulham.

    Chelsea v Sunderland
    •Chelsea will set a new Premier League record of 12 consecutive wins by one team against a single opponent if they beat Sunderland.
    •The Blues have scored 18 goals in their last four Premier League games against the Black Cats.
    •Nicolas Anelka has scored six goals in three games for Chelsea against Sunderland.
    •The Pensioners have not conceded a goal in the last 871 minutes of Premier League football at Stamford Bridge.
    •Sunderland have only won one of their last 24 Premier League away matches, but have drawn four of the last five.
    •Sunderland have failed to score on eight of their last 10 trips to London in the top flight.

    Everton v Arsenal
    •Robin van Persie has scored four goals in six appearances against Everton in the Premier League.
    •Before this weekend's matches, Arsenal had picked up more points (11) away from home than any other side in the Premier League.
    •Everton have only lost one of their last 18 Premier League matches at Goodison Park.
    •Chelsea are the only team to stop Arsenal scoring away from home in the last 12 Premier League away games for the Gunners.
    •Arsenal haven't kept three consecutive clean sheets away from home in the Premier League since May 2005.
